摘 要:Gupta et al., proposed a method, which is referred to as the Iterative RelaxationMethod, to generate test data for a given path in a program by linearizing the predicate functions.In this paper, a model language is presented and the properties of static and dynamic data depen-dencies are investigated. The notions in the Iterative Relaxation Method are defined formally. Thepredicate slice proposed by Gupta et al. is extended to path-wise static slice. The correctness ofthe constructional algorithm is proved afterward. The improvement shows that the constructionsof predicate slice and input dependency set can be omitted. The equivalence of systems of con-straints generated by both methods is proved. The prototype of path-wise test data generator ispresented in this paper. The experiments show that our method is practical, and fits the path-wiseautomatic generation of test data for both white-box testing and black-box testing.
